About Murinact Sachet 8 gm
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is an antibiotic used to treat or prevent bladder infections. Bladder infection is mostly caused by a bacterial infection within the bladder.
Murinact Sachet 8 gm contains Fosfomycin, which inhibits the formation of the bacterial cell wall (a protective covering) necessary for survival. Thus, it kills bacteria. Additionally, Murinact Sachet 8 gm reduces the attachment of bacteria to cells lining the urinary bladder, thereby preventing bladder infections.
In some cases, you may experience dizziness, headache, indigestion, and vulvovaginitis (swelling or infection of the vulva and vagina) as side effects of Murinact Sachet 8 gm. Most of these side effects do not require medical attention and gradually resolve over time. However, if the side effects persist or worsen, please consult your doctor.
Please tell your doctor if you are allergic to Murinact Sachet 8 gm. If you are pregnant or breastfeeding, please inform your doctor before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m. Murinact Sachet 8 gm is not recommended for children below 12 years of age.
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is contraindicated in patients with severe kidney problems and patients undergoing hemodialysis (a process of purifying blood by filtering out extra fluids and wastes when the kidneys are not working). If you previously had diarrhoea caused by other antibiotics, inform your doctor before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m.

Alcohol
Caution
The interaction of alcohol with Murinact Sachet 8 gm is unknown. However, limit or avoid consumption of alcohol while ta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m.
Pregnancy
Caution
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is a category B pregnancy drug and is given to pregnant women only if the doctor thinks the benefits outweigh the risks. Therefore, please inform your doctor if you are pregnant or planning a pregnancy before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m.
Breast Feeding
Caution
Small amounts of Murinact Sachet 8 gm are excreted in human milk. Therefore, it is given to breastfeeding mothers only if the doctor thinks the benefits are greater than the risks.
Driving
Caution
Murinact Sachet 8 gm may cause dizziness or tiredness in some people. Therefore, avoid driving if you experience any of these symptoms after ta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m.
Liver
Consult your doctor
Limited information is available on the effect of Murinact Sachet 8 gm in patients with liver disease. Therefore, inform your doctor if you have any liver diseases/conditions before taking this medicine.
Kidney
Caution
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is not recommended if you have severe kidney problems or are undergoing hemodialysis. Inform your doctor if you have any Kidney problems before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m.
Children
Unsafe
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is not recommended for children below 12 years of age as the safety and effectiveness were not established.
Heart
Consult your doctor
Exercise caution while ta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m if you have any cardiac related problems.
Geriatrics
Safe if prescribed
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is safe for use in elderly patients if prescribed by the physician.
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is used to treat or prevent bladder infections.
Murinact Sachet 8 gm contains Fosfomycin, which inhibits the formation of the bacterial cell wall (a protective covering) necessary for their survival. Thus, it kills bacteria. Also, Murinact Sachet 8 gm decreases the attachment of bacteria to cells lining the urinary bladder.
Murinact Sachet 8 gm is not recommended in patients undergoing hemodialysis (a process of purifying blood by filtering out extra fluids and wastes when kidneys are not working) as the excretion of Murinact Sachet 8 gm may be reduced in such patients leading to the accumulation of Murinact Sachet 8 gm in the body. Therefore, please inform your doctor if you are undergoing hemodialysis before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m so that alternative medicine may be prescribed.
Yes, Murinact Sachet 8 gm may cause headaches as a common side effect. However, if the condition persists or worsens, please consult a doctor.
You are not recommended to take Murinact Sachet 8 gm with metoclopramide as co-administration of these two medicines may reduce the absorption of Murinact Sachet 8 gm. However, please consult your doctor before ta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m with other medicines.
You are not recommended to stop ta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m without consulting your doctor, as it may worsen the infection or cause recurring symptoms. Therefore, complete the full course of antibiotics and take Murinact Sachet 8 gm for as long as your doctor has prescribed it, and if you experience any difficulty while taking Murinact Sachet 8 gm, please consult your doctor.
